How to evaluate the mechanical condition of a used excavator?
When sourcing a used excavator, the priority is the engine and hydraulic system. Check for black or blue smoke from the exhaust, which indicates engine wear. Inspect the hydraulic pumps and cylinders for leaks or scoring. It is essential to verify the operating hours; typically, a machine with under 5,000 hours is considered high-value, while those over 10,000 hours require a comprehensive overhaul assessment.
What are the key structural inspection points for used construction machinery?
Examine the boom, arm, and bucket for any signs of welding repairs or cracks, which suggest structural fatigue. Check the swing bearing (slewing ring) for excessive play. For crawler excavators, evaluate the undercarriage wear (rollers, idlers, and track links); if the undercarriage is more than 70% worn, factor in the high cost of replacement into your negotiation.
Which compliance standards and certifications are necessary for importing used excavators?
Compliance varies by destination. For the USA, the engine must meet EPA Tier emission standards. For the EU, a CE marking and compliance with Stage V emissions are often required. Always request the Original Certificate of Conformity and the De-registration Certificate from the country of origin to ensure the machine is not stolen and can be legally imported.
How to ensure the authenticity of the machine's history and brand?
Verify the Product Identification Number (PIN) or Serial Number against the manufacturer's database (e.g., Caterpillar, Komatsu, or Sany). Cross-reference the maintenance logs to ensure regular oil changes and filter replacements were performed. Be wary of repainted machines that may hide rust or structural damage; always ask for 'work-site' photos before the refurbishment.
Cross-Border Procurement Risks and Strategies for Used Heavy Equipment
What are the common risks in purchasing used machinery across borders?
The biggest risk is misrepresentation of condition. To mitigate this, hire a third-party inspection agency (like SGS or CCIC) to conduct a pre-shipment inspection. Another risk is transaction fraud; always use Secure Payment services or Letters of Credit (L/C). How should I negotiate with suppliers for used excavators?
Negotiate based on the Residual Value. Use the cost of wear-part replacement (tires, tracks, teeth) as leverage to lower the price. Request a bundled price that includes the cost of export wooden packaging and anti-corrosion wax coating for sea transport. Ask for a warranty on major components (engine/main pump) for at least 3-6 months post-arrival.
What are the logistics and shipping precautions for heavy machinery?
Used excavators are typically shipped via Roll-on/Roll-off (RoRo) or Flat Rack containers. Ensure the supplier provides professional lashing and bracing to prevent movement during transit. Because used machinery can carry soil, many countries (like Australia or the USA) require stringent steam cleaning to pass quarantine/biosecurity inspections; ensure this is documented in the contract.
How to handle international trade policy and customs clearance?
Check if your country imposes anti-dumping duties or specific import licenses for used goods. Ensure the Commercial Invoice clearly states the machine is 'Used' and includes the HS Code (usually 842952). Work with a customs broker experienced in heavy equipment to navigate environmental regulations and valuation appraisals by customs officials.
